1.0 OBJECTIVE To lay down the Procedure for Receipt, Storage and Stock Maintenance of Dehydrated Media in Microbiology Laboratory. 2.0 SCOPE This procedure is applicable for Receipt, Storage and Stock Maintenance of Dehydrated Media in Microbiology Laboratory in the Quality Control Department of Microbiology Area. 3.0 RESPONSIBILITY • Microbiologist : is responsible for receive, storage and maintain stock as per SOP. 4.0 ACCOUNTABILITY • Department Head 5.0 PROCEDURE 5.1 Receipt of Dehydrated Media 5.1.1 Media Shall be received from the certified manufacture/supplier (Hi-media/Micro express) 5.1.2 During receiving the media container’s physical observation shall be done by microbiologist to check for media container seal integrity or any physical damage, if seal is found broken or media box is badly damaged then media shall be returned to supplier. 5.1.3 During receiving the media, the certificate of analysis of the media shall be cross checked and verified by microbiologist for expiry of media, storage condition of the media, and lot number of media. 5.1.4 After receiving of dehydrated media, GPT shall be performed within 10 days for each lot of media as per respective SOP. 5.1.5 Dehydrated media should not be used without GPT test, after passing in GPT, dehydrated media shall be ready for use. 5.1.6 Each newly received media box shall be tested and approved for GPT before taken in to routine use. 5.1.7 If same lot no of media is received in such case single box shall be checked for GPT initially. File the COA with the growth promotion test report of the medium. 5.2.3 Assigning a container, no, as AA/BB Where; AA = Container No. /= separator BB= total no. of container received. E.g. if 10 media container of are received the number of container will be 01/10 and so on. After entry in format No. XXX and given assigning no. affix a label on media container as per format No. XXX. 5.3 Storage of Dehydrated Media 5.3.1 The dehydrated media are highly hygroscopic and must be stored as per the supplier storage condition mentioned on the media label. 5.3.2 The temperature of the microbiological media storage room/facility shall be monitored through a min/max thermometer and the limit shall be followed as per the media storage requirement. 5.3.3 List of media having storage condition and pH limit shall be prepared as per format No. XXX. 5.4 Usage of Dehydrated Media 5.4.1 At the time of media preparation, media shall be taken and mentioned date of opening on label on container shall be written at the time of container opening. 5.4.2 Media container shall be used as per FIFO basis. 5.4.3 The opened media container shall be tightly closed and stored at media storage condition. |
